I have integrated https://giscus.app/ with my blog. It uses github discussions as the comment database, and you can use github discussions for moderation. It does not use any external service, it's some javascript you inject into the page, which injects a github discussions 'new post' iframe or something like that. Users authorize with github and place the discussion post as their own user. The javascript in the blog article simply requests all comments on the discussion for that blog article client side.
